The SIMPSON STRONG TIE ABW44Z is an adjustable post base designed to anchor 4-inch x 4-inch posts to concrete foundations with a built-in 1-inch standoff elevation. That standoff keeps the post end-grain off the slab surface, reducing moisture contact and slowing decay at the base. Fabricated from 16-gauge steel and finished with Zmax galvanization, this base resists corrosion in wet and outdoor environments. The design incorporates geometry that improves uplift load resistance, contributing to structural performance under wind and lateral loads. Licensed contractors and structural carpenters install this base in decks, pergolas, carports, and similar post-frame assemblies.
The ABW44Z is suited for residential and light commercial post-frame construction where concrete footings or slabs serve as the bearing surface. Typical applications include deck posts, pergola columns, carport uprights, and covered patio structures. The base is sold in a package quantity of 10 units, making it practical for multi-post projects. Installation is performed by licensed contractors or structural carpenters following applicable building codes, including IBC and local jurisdictional requirements. Set the 1/2-inch anchor bolt in cured concrete before positioning the base plate; confirm anchor embedment depth meets the project engineer or code requirement before fastening. Secure the post with the specified nails or Strong Drive SD screws through all provided fastener holes to achieve rated load values. Do not substitute fastener types or quantities, as load ratings are based on the specified fastening schedule.
